哈喽,亲爱的小伙伴们!今天咱们来讲讲一个神技能——怎样远程连接云服务器。是不是觉得一想到“远程连接”就头晕晕、脑瓜子嗡?别慌别慌,这篇文章包你吃透,手把手让你成为云端操作的小萌新,秒变“云端大佬”。准备好了吗?那我们就开启“云端穿梭”模式!
一、准备工作:搞定一切“跑步鞋”——客户端和权限
1. 安装相应工具:常用的远程连接工具比如PuTTY(Windows平台)、Termius、MobaXterm,或Mac自带的Terminal。如果你是Linux党,那个,无需找工具,直接用终端就完事儿。
2. 获取云服务器的IP地址:登陆云平台控制台找到实例详情,看见“弹指一挥间,IP就在我手上”。记住,公网IP和私有IP是不同的,小心别写错。
3. 拿到ssh密钥对:在云平台创建实例时,建议使用密钥对登录,安全性杠杠的。如果是密码登录也可以,但相对风险要大一些。
4. 设置安全组规则:打开云平台的安全组,允许22端口(默认SSH端口)通行。这一步很重要,没开通可能就会“死活连不上”云端大佬。
二、连接流程:登堂入室的步骤
1. 打开终端(命令行窗口):
- Windows:可以用PuTTY或PowerShell。
- Mac/Linux:直接打开终端。
2. 输入连接命令(以Linux云服务器为例):
```bash
ssh -i /path/to/your/private_key.pem username@ip_address
```
比如:
```bash
ssh -i ~/.ssh/id_rsa root@123.45.67.89
```
这条命令,简直就是“江湖绝技”——它在告诉云端:“嘿,老铁,我是你们的远程操控者”。
3. 如果是用密码登录的话,命令可能是:
```bash
ssh username@ip_address
```
然后会让你输入密码,输入完毕后,小心别被钓鱼。
4. 连接成功,那就意味着你在云端“置身事外,说走就走”!恭喜你,成为了“云端玩家”。
三、遇到问题?别慌,常见问题解决方案来了
- “连接超时怎么办?”:确认安全组规则,把22端口放开;或者VPN设置有误。
- “权限被拒绝”:“是不是私钥位置错了?权限太松了?”私钥权限要确保是600(只有自己能读写),用命令:
```bash
chmod 600 /path/to/your/private_key.pem
```
- “密码错误怎么办?”:重新核实密码,或者重置密码。
- “无法找到命令ssh”:“你是Windows还是Mac?”Windows用户推荐用PuTTY,Mac/Linux用户,终端自带的ssh就行。
四、图形界面连接(GUI版)—更直观的操作体验
如果你嫌用命令太“心累”,也可以用图形界面工具,比如:
- **Xshell**(Windows):支持多标签、多会话,操作像操作电脑一样方便。
- **MobaXterm**(Windows):集成了X11服务器,解放你的鼠标。
- **Cyberduck / FileZilla**:文件传输轻松搞定,拖拖拽拽就是“云端文件管理公司”。
- **VNC、NoMachine**:需要在云端装上VNC服务器,然后在本地连接“云中小家”。
五、安全连接的“小技巧”秘籍:别让“黑客们”有可乘之机
- 更改默认端口:不要老用22端口,改成更隐蔽的,比如22022,避免被“扫地出门”。
- 禁用密码登录,开启密钥对认证——就像“金刚不坏之身”。
- 配置防火墙:只允许信任IP访问,仿佛给云端罩上一层“钢铁盔甲”。
- 定时审查:每天看一下谁连接了你的云端,别让“黑帮”跑进来吃豆腐。
六、其他“神操作”——远程管理神器
- 配置VPN:让云端与本地“无缝对接”,安全又高效。
- 配置多阶验证:除了密钥,还搞个验证码,像追剧一样追着“攻城狮”。
- 利用云平台自带的远程桌面服务:AWS的Session Manager、Azure的Jump Box……多一层保险,操控更顺畅。
说了这么多,是不是已经有点跃跃欲试了?别忘了,玩游戏想赚零花钱就上七评赏金榜,网站地址:bbs.77.ink,顺便让你的小手指点一下,收藏一下,动作要快!
最后,记得“远程连接”就像开车,要稳扎稳打别乱跑,要规范操作不然容易“炸锅”。当然也别忘了,偶尔用点幽默调剂生活,云端的“司机”也会越来越溜,小心别让云“跑偏”了!